Northwest Suburban Powerhouse
Schaumburg is a village in Cook and DuPage counties with rapid access via I-90 and IL-53/I-290. It’s a regional destination for shopping, dining, entertainment, and corporate campuses.
Neighborhoods & Districts
Residential areas include single-family neighborhoods, townhomes, and modern multifamily near parks and schools. Commercial districts feature a walkable core with restaurants, theaters, and event spaces.
Economy & Employers
Technology, professional services, retail, hospitality, healthcare, and logistics compose a highly diversified economy. Large employment centers and convention venues draw visitors year-round.
Mobility & Transit
Pace express buses, the Metra MD–West station, and regional bike routes support commuting options. Wide arterials and structured parking simplify errands and nights out.
Parks, Nature & Sports
Residents enjoy athletic complexes, aquatic centers, golf, and nature areas. Nearby preserves and multi-use paths offer long rides and runs across the Northwest Corridor.
Culture, Events & Nightlife
Concerts, festivals, seasonal markets, and sports events sustain a busy civic calendar that complements the village’s entertainment districts.
